A vector \(\vec A \) is rotated by a small angle \(\Delta \theta\) radian \(( \Delta \theta << 1)\) to get a new vector \(\vec B\) In that case \(\left| {\vec B - \vec A} \right|\) is
- A \(\left| {\vec A} \right|\,\Delta \theta \)
- B \(\left| {\vec B} \right|\,\Delta \theta - \left| {\vec A} \right|\,\)
- C \(\left| {\vec A} \right|\,\left( {1 - \frac{{\Delta {\theta ^2}}}{2}} \right)\)
- D \(0\)
Answer & Solution
Correct Answer
(A) \(\left| {\vec A} \right|\,\Delta \theta \)
Step-by-step Solution
Detailed explanation
\(\begin{array}{l} Arc\,length\, = \,radius \times angle\\ So,\,\left| {\vec B - \vec A} \right| = \left| {\vec A} \right|\Delta \theta \end{array}\)
